The separation of nucleic acids is achieved via their catching by very details binding M-PVA Magnetic Grains that are thereafter drawn in to metal poles, allured by an electromagnet. This causes high return purity DNA/RNA for downstream applications. The system includes three default methods for slow-moving, medium and also rapid removal of nucleic acids which the individual can choose based on the need.

The procedure begins with an owner which fits as much as 400 microwell plates-- 200 for input as well as 200 for result. of endogenous proteins from the surface of dried out blood places as well as example preparation through trypsin food digestion by utilize of the Advion Biosciences Triversa Nanomate robot system. Liquid chromatography tandem mass spectrometry of the resulting digests allowed identification of 120 healthy proteins from a single dried blood spot. The proteins determined cross a focus range of 4 orders of magnitude. However, making use of whole-genome sequencing approach, 57 (81.4%) isolates were S. pneumoniae isolates, 37 (65%) were acquired from youngsters matured between 38 days to 18 years; the remaining 20 stress (35%) were recouped from grown-up clients. Out of the 37 children, 20 had obtained PCV10 vaccination (age-based injection status), covering 35.1% out of all patients with intrusive as well as non-invasive infection. The clinical resources of isolates were cerebrospinal liquid 20 (35.1%), blood 12 (21.1%), eye discharge 10 (17.5%), spit 10 (17.5%), pleural liquid 2 (3.5%), ear discharge 2 (3.5%) as well as peritoneal liquid 1 (1.8%). A hospital-based potential study was performed from January 2018 to 2019 at Addis Ababa and Amhara Area Referral Hospitals, Ethiopia. During the study period, an overall of 70 phenotypically verified S. pneumoniae were isolated from pediatric and grown-up individuals suspected of pneumococcal infections.

A cornerstone of accuracy medication is the recognition as well as use biomarkers that help subtype clients for targeted treatment. Such a method needs the development and subsequent investigation of massive biobanks connected to well-annotated clinical information. Standard methods of developing these data-linked biobanks are pricey as well as lengthy, especially in severe conditions that require time-sensitive scientific data and biospecimens.
